To enable CON3 and disable CON1,
transfer jumper to pins 2 & 3 on J1, J2, J3 & J4
To enable CON4 and disable CON2,
transfer jumper to pins 2 & 3 on J5, J6, J7 & J8

Using the RAID BIOS to create RAID Volumes
There are four configurations supported:
RAID level/Type | Configurations | Number of disks needed |
RAID 0 | Disk Striping | 2 or 3 or 4 |
RAID 1 | Disk Mirroring | 2 |
RAID 0+1 | Disk Striping + Mirroring | 4 |
JBOD | Disk Concatenation | 2 or 3 or 4 |
RAID 0 (Striping)
1.Press Ctrl+J when prompted to enter the RAID BIOS.
2.At the next screen select Create RAID Disk Drive, press Enter.
3.Enter RAID name, press Enter.
4.Use arrow keys • and •to switch the RAID level to
5.Use arrow keys • and •to switch the disk, use the “space” key to mark the selected disk, then press Enter.
6.Use arrow keys • and • to select chunk size from 4K, 8K, 16K, 32K, 64K or 128K, then press Enter.
7.Input the RAID size, press Enter.
8.When asked Create RAID on the select HDD (Y/N)?, press Y to accept.
9.At the next screen select Save And Exit Setup, press Enter.
10.When asked Save to disk &Exit (Y/N)?, press Y to exit the RAID BIOS.
RAID 1 (Mirroring)
1.Press Ctrl+J when prompted to enter the RAID BIOS.
2.At the next screen select Create RAID Disk Drive, press Enter.
3.Enter RAID name, press Enter.
4.Use arrow keys • and •to switch the RAID level to
5.Use arrow keys • and •to switch the disk, use the “space” key to mark the selected disk, then press Enter.
6.Input the RAID size, press Enter.
7.When asked Create RAID on the select HDD (Y/N)?, press Y to accept.
8.At the next screen select Save And Exit Setup, press Enter.
9.When asked Save to disk &Exit (Y/N)?, press Y to exit the BIOS.
